Corinium Museum

Fodor's Review:

Not much of the Roman town remains visible, but the Corinium Museum displays an outstanding collection of Roman artifacts, including mosaic pavements, as well as full-scale reconstructions of local Roman interiors. Spacious galleries explore the town's history in Roman and Anglo-Saxon times and in the 18th century; they include plenty of hands-on exhibits.

  • Cost: £3.70
  • Open: Mon.-Sat. 10-5, Sun. 2-5
